Fixed/updated version of my video about retro-crypto
Retro-Crypto for the Nintendo 64 is an open-source app that lets you generate keys, encrypt and decrypt data, and more. It's still in development, but I thought I should hurry up and finish this showcase video after the recent ColdCard hacks. Now I have to post this fixed version, which has been updated to accept up to 100 dice rolls when generating a seed.
The N64 ROM and source code are embedded in the corner of the video, using VideoStore Codec by Digital Assistant. The minimum required resolution to extract the files from this video seems to be 720p, based on my testing before posting.
